为网络负载均衡器启动可用区转移 - Elastic Load Balancing
Amazon Web Services 文档中描述的 Amazon Web Services 服务或功能可能因区域而异。要查看适用于中国区域的差异,请参阅 中国的 Amazon Web Services 服务入门 (PDF)

为网络负载均衡器启动可用区转移

ARC 中的可用区转移使您能够将受支持资源的流量暂时迁出可用区,从而让您的应用程序能够继续在 Amazon 区域内的其他可用区正常运行。

先决条件

在开始之前,请确认您已为负载均衡器负载均衡器启用可用区转移

Console

本程序说明了如何使用 Amazon EC2 控制台来启动可用区转移。有关使用 ARC 控制台启动可用区转移的步骤,请参阅《Amazon 应用程序恢复控制器(ARC)开发人员指南》中的 Starting a zonal shift

启动可用区转移
  1. 通过以下网址打开 Amazon EC2 控制台:https://console.aws.amazon.com/ec2/

  2. 在导航窗格上的 Load Balancing(负载均衡)下,选择 Load Balancers(负载均衡器)。

  3. 选择网络负载均衡器。

  4. 集成选项卡中,展开 Amazon Application Recovery Controller (ARC),然后选择启动可用区转移

  5. 选择要将流量移离的可用区。

  6. 选择或输入可用区转移的到期时间。可用区转移最初可以从 1 分钟设置为三天(72 小时)。

    所有可用区转移都是暂时的。您必须设置过期时间,但可以稍后更新活跃转移以设置新的过期时间。

  7. 输入注释。您可以稍后更新可用区转移以编辑注释。

  8. 选中该复选框以确认启动可用区转移,这会将流量移离该可用区,从而减少应用程序的容量。

  9. 选择确认

Amazon CLI
启动可用区转移

使用 Amazon Application Recovery Controller (ARC) 的 start-zonal-shift 命令。

aws arc-zonal-shift start-zonal-shift \ --resource-identifier load-balancer-arn \ --away-from use2-az2 \ --expires-in 2h \ --comment "zonal shift due to scheduled maintenance"